I have "allowed discovery" on the laptop bluetooth settings.
Switch on Bluetooth on the phone and "tap" the laptop name on screen..... to connect... it then shows "pairing"...and another screen appears with a box which tells me to "enter your pin to connect"
Don`t know about a PIN number... have no recollection of setting one up on the phone... or the laptop...
If I put a "random" 4 figure number in.... I get a popup window on the laptop saying some bluetooth wants to connect... click this message... the message immediately disappears and ..... nothing...
the phone shows... "not connected".... and checking on the bluetooth icon..." Check bluetooth devices"... no devices are shown...
presumably that is because the pin number is incorrect...
so... my query is... how do I find out what my pin number is ? or is there something I need to do to set a pin number for the bluetooth to work ?

As for connecting to my mobiles, I don't remember having to enter a PIN.
You mention that the Lumia is set to be discoverable but is there also a setting to Allow devices to connect in the Bluetooth software on the laptop and is this ticked?
Have the correct, up-to-date drivers been installed properly? Go to Control Panel - Device Manager and see if you have any warnings there.
Can you try a different control software for the Bluetooth on the laptop?
